Easy Raspberry Sauce
Learn how to make Raspberry Sauce that is a fresh and tasty addition to cake, cheesecake, ice-cream, or yogurt. This easy raspberry sauce recipe needs 6 ingredients, and it’s quick to make at home. The best dessert sauce recipe ever!

Ingredients
12
oz
fresh or frozen raspberries
about 2 1/2 cups
1/2
cup
sweetener
1/3
cup
Water
1
tbsp
Lemon Juice
2
tsp
Vanilla Extract
1
tbsp
butter
Pinch
of salt
Instructions
In a saucepan over medium heat, add the fresh or frozen raspberries, sweetener, water, and lemon juice.
Bring the mixture to a boil, stirring constantly. Reduce the heat and let it simmer for 4-5 minutes or until desired thickness.
Remove the saucepan from the heat and add in the vanilla, butter and a pinch of salt. Mix well until the butter has melted.
Let the sauce cool for at least 15 minutes and Serve with your favorite dessert.
Store the le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
Notes
Makes About 2 cups Raspberry Sauce
